Best Desk-Size: Putt-A-Bout Par 1
BEST OVERALL
- Pros
- $45 — cheapest quality mat available
- Ball return saves constant bending
- 9 ft length allows real stroke practice
- Folds flat for storage under a desk
- Cons
- Single hole position — no adjustable break
- Surface is slightly faster than average greens
- Not long enough for 15+ foot putt practice

Best Premium: BirdieBall Putting Green
BEST HOME SETUP
- Pros
- Closest to real green feel indoors
- Adjustable break with foam wedges
- Available up to 4x18 ft for serious setups
- Cons
- $169 is a real investment for a mat
- Requires a dedicated room — too big for a cubicle
- No ball return — manual ball retrieval
